
On February 1, Beijing time, breaking news came from Chinese soccer. In response to the issue of salary arrears in the Chinese Super League (CSL), Tianjin media outlet Daily News has revealed that the situation in Guangzhou, Dalian and Shenzhen is not good, which has caused a lot of controversy.
As we all know, the Chinese Super League in the last two seasons due to the continuous tournament system, as well as the gold dollar soccer and the parent company's poor operating conditions, resulting in large-scale arrears in the Chinese Super League, including Beijing Guoan, Shanghai Shenhua and other Chinese Super League giants, but also led to the negative news of the Chinese Super League, the Football Association has also made up its mind to relegate the delinquent teams.
But now, most teams have overcome the difficulties, only a few teams are in a difficult situation, in this regard, the Daily News wrote: "The Chinese Super League Guangzhou, Dalian, Shenzhen, three clubs are not optimistic, although the Henan Songshan Longmen arrears, but can not be resolved, the other clubs to solve the arrears of wages act faster."
From the Daily News report, it can be seen that Guangzhou, Dalian and Shenzhen teams may not be able to solve the problem of salary arrears, although the media did not disclose the specific information, but this situation is not only the destruction of the Chinese Super League, but also makes Xie Hui, Li Weifeng and Zhang Xiaorui very helpless, after all, they led the team to avoid relegation, if they can not solve the problem of salary arrears, it will also turn their efforts into nothing, and the fans also ridicule.
